Aprenda programação do zero: Guia completo para iniciantes

blog
PUBLICADO 20 DE MAIO DE 2023

Inicie sua jornada na programação e construa uma carreira promissora. Aprenda do zero, escolha a melhor linguagem e domine habilidades essenciais. Prepare-se para o mercado de tecnologia!

Neste guia, detalharemos como você pode aprender programação do zero.

Vamos explorar os recursos disponíveis, as linguagens de programação mais relevantes e as melhores práticas para começar sua jornada.

Boa leitura!

O que é programação?

A programação é o processo de desenvolvimento de instruções que podem ser entendidas e executadas por dispositivos eletrônicos, como computadores, smartphones e tablets.

Essas instruções são escritas em linguagens de programação, que são projetadas para serem facilmente compreendidas pelos seres humanos e, ao mesmo tempo, eficientemente processadas pelos dispositivos.

Para aprender programação, é necessário desenvolver habilidades em raciocínio lógico, resolução de problemas e pensamento estruturado.

Essas habilidades não só são úteis na programação, mas também podem ser aplicadas em outras áreas do conhecimento, como comunicação e gerenciamento de projetos.

Por que aprender programação?

Aprender programação traz diversos benefícios, tanto para sua vida profissional quanto pessoal.

Algumas razões para aprender programação incluem:

  1. Mercado de trabalho em crescimento: A demanda por profissionais de tecnologia continua crescendo, com estimativas apontando a necessidade de quase 800 mil profissionais até 2025. Aprender programação pode abrir portas para uma carreira promissora e bem remunerada.

  2. Flexibilidade profissional: Profissionais de programação podem trabalhar em uma ampla variedade de setores, desde desenvolvimento web e criação de aplicativos até análise de dados e automação de processos.

  3. Desenvolvimento pessoal: Aprender programação ajuda a desenvolver habilidades de raciocínio lógico, resolução de problemas e pensamento estruturado, que são úteis em diversas áreas da vida.

  4. Criatividade: A programação permite que você crie soluções inovadoras para problemas, desenvolva novas ferramentas e explore sua criatividade.

Escolhendo uma linguagem de programação

Antes de começar a aprender programação, é importante escolher uma linguagem de programação para se concentrar. Existem inúmeras linguagens disponíveis, cada uma com suas próprias vantagens e desvantagens.

Algumas das linguagens mais populares e versáteis para iniciantes incluem:

  • Python: Uma linguagem de alto nível, fácil de aprender e amplamente utilizada em desenvolvimento web, automação, machine learning e data science. Empresas como YouTube, Google e Instagram usam Python em suas aplicações.

  • JavaScript: Uma linguagem de programação amplamente utilizada para desenvolvimento web, especialmente para criar interações dinâmicas no front-end de sites e aplicativos. Com o uso de frameworks como o React e o Node.js, JavaScript também pode ser utilizado no back-end.

  • Java: Uma linguagem confiável e versátil, usada em uma ampla gama de aplicações, desde desenvolvimento de sistemas operacionais até jogos e aplicativos para dispositivos móveis. Java é conhecida por ser multiplataforma e multiparadigma, o que a torna uma escolha popular para muitos projetos.

  • C#: Desenvolvida pela Microsoft, essa linguagem é baseada na C++ e é amplamente utilizada no ecossistema de tecnologia da empresa.

  • PHP: Uma linguagem de código aberto e fácil de aprender, utilizada principalmente em desenvolvimento web. Aproximadamente 80% dos sites são escritos em PHP.

Ao escolher uma linguagem de programação, considere seus objetivos e interesses profissionais.

Por exemplo, se você deseja trabalhar com desenvolvimento de jogos, linguagens como C++, C# e Java podem ser mais adequadas.

Se você prefere desenvolver sites, HTML, CSS e JavaScript são essenciais.

Primeiros passos para aprender programação

Ao começar a aprender programação, é importante seguir um plano de estudo estruturado e consistente.

Aqui estão algumas etapas para ajudá-lo a começar:

1. Explore recursos educacionais

Existem várias opções disponíveis para aprender programação, como cursos online, vídeos, sites, cursos técnicos, faculdades e bootcamps.

Pesquise sobre as diferentes opções e escolha aquela que melhor se adapta ao seu estilo de aprendizado e disponibilidade.

2. Desenvolva habilidades em raciocínio lógico

Antes de mergulhar no aprendizado de uma linguagem de programação específica, é importante desenvolver habilidades em raciocínio lógico e resolução de problemas.

Isso facilitará a compreensão dos conceitos de programação e a aplicação prática dessas habilidades.

3. Pratique constantemente

A prática é fundamental para desenvolver habilidades em programação.

Dedique tempo para estudar e praticar diariamente, mesmo que seja por períodos curtos.

Quanto mais você pratica, mais rápido você aprenderá e melhorará suas habilidades.

4. Crie projetos pessoais

Uma ótima maneira de aplicar o que você aprendeu é criar projetos pessoais.

Isso ajudará você a solidificar seus conhecimentos e a ganhar experiência prática no desenvolvimento de soluções do mundo real.

5. Participe da comunidade

Envolver-se com a comunidade de programação pode ser extremamente valioso.

Participe de fóruns, grupos de discussão e redes sociais profissionais como o LinkedIn.

Aprenda com colegas, compartilhe suas experiências e mantenha-se atualizado sobre as últimas tendências e tecnologias do setor.

6. Tenha paciência e persistência

Aprender programação pode ser desafiador e levar tempo.

Tenha paciência consigo mesmo e persista em seus esforços.

Com dedicação e trabalho árduo, você eventualmente dominará as habilidades necessárias para se tornar um programador bem-sucedido.

Estimativa de tempo para aprender programação

Com dedicação e esforço, é possível começar a entender os conceitos básicos de programação e se familiarizar com uma ou duas linguagens em cerca de dois meses.

No entanto, é importante lembrar que um programador estará sempre em aprendizado, e aperfeiçoar suas habilidades levará tempo e prática contínua.

Estudando programação de forma autodidata

Embora aprender programação por conta própria possa ser desafiador, é possível com determinação e acesso aos recursos certos.

Defina seus objetivos de aprendizado, pesquise e estude materiais relevantes e pratique constantemente.

Fóruns e comunidades online podem ser úteis para tirar dúvidas e compartilhar experiências.

Linguagens de programação mais populares em 2023

Uma das linguagens de programação mais populares e amplamente utilizadas atualmente é o Java.

Focado em serviços, o Java é utilizado em uma variedade de soluções empresariais e integra-se facilmente com outras tecnologias.

Desafios no aprendizado de programação

Aprender programação pode ser difícil, especialmente no início.

No entanto, com comprometimento, paciência e persistência, é possível dominar essa habilidade.

Estudar regularmente, praticar e buscar feedback são fundamentais para o sucesso no aprendizado de programação.

Conclusão

Aprender programação do zero é uma jornada desafiadora, mas extremamente gratificante.

Com as informações e dicas fornecidas neste guia, você estará bem preparado para iniciar sua jornada e aproveitar as oportunidades oferecidas pelo crescente mercado de tecnologia em 2023.

Não deixe de explorar os recursos disponíveis, praticar constantemente e se envolver com a comunidade de programação para garantir seu sucesso nesse campo empolgante.

Boa sorte!